Joan, a private school administrator from Maryland, initially appeared as a contestant onThe Golden Bachelorseason 1. When things didn’t work out with Gerry Turner, Joan was cast asThe Golden Bachelorette.Chock, an insurance executive from Kansas, was one of the24 singleGoldenmen vying for Joan’s heart. After a roller coaster of a season, Joan gave her final rose to Chock, andhe proposed with a sparkling diamond ring. It’s hard to tell how much of Joan and Chock’s relationship is real and how much is fiction. Joan and Chock fell in love during the show and seem genuinely happy to have found each other. They’d both lived wholelives filled with joy and sorrow on the road to meeting each otheronThe Golden Bacheloretteseason 1. Joan was married to John Vassos for 32 years before he passed away in 2021. Chock himself was no stranger to loss. His fiancée of nine years, Katherine Goree, died in 2022.

Chock may have won Joan’s last rose, but he didn’t win Joan’s first rose. That honor went to 62-year-old Keith Gordon during the premiere night ofThe Golden Bacheloretteseason 1. Chock got something just as good whenJoan gave him her first solo date of the season. The couple spent the day at Disneyland and had a great time bonding. They met some beloved characters, had a romantic dinner, rode some rides, and kissed under a sky full of fireworks.

Their first date at Disneyland really left an impression on Joan and Chock.

Since getting engaged at the end ofThe Golden Bacheloretteseason 1, Joan and Chock have been back to Disneyland.Joanrecently posted a video they filmed during a recent trip to the Magic Kingdom. They were joined by several other reality TV stars,including fan favorites Kathy Swarts and Susan NolesfromThe Golden Bachelorseason 1. Joan and Chock have also talked about taking their families to Disneyland for a bonding vacation, so the place is obviously special for them. It’s also great social media content.
